Quartz features

Quartz Kitchen Islands, Splashbacks, Upstands and Waterfall Ends

A good quartz design is planned before fabrication starts. Islands, splashbacks, upstands and waterfall ends need accurate slab planning, support checks, access planning and clear decisions on visible edges.

Quartz kitchen islands

Island tops can include seating overhangs, waterfall ends, mitred details and practical seam planning where slab sizes require it.

Quartz splashbacks

Matching quartz splashbacks provide a clean finish behind hobs and sinks and reduce grout lines compared with tiled finishes.

Quartz upstands

Upstands protect wall edges and help create a neat finish where walls are not perfectly straight.

Quartz waterfall ends

Waterfall ends need careful measuring, mitred fabrication and safe handling, especially for larger Camberley island layouts.

Quartz Edge Profiles, Thickness Options and Cut-Outs

Most Camberley quartz worktops are specified in 20mm or 30mm thickness. A pencil edge gives a soft practical finish, a bevel edge adds a refined angled detail and a mitred edge can create a thicker visual apron or waterfall end.

Before fabrication, we confirm sink type, hob size, tap holes, drainer groove direction, appliance clearances, support panels, overhangs, splashback heights and any visible returns.

Safe quartz fabrication

Safe Engineered Quartz Fabrication for Camberley Projects

Quartz worktops should be planned and fabricated professionally. The safest and cleanest approach is to template accurately at the property, then carry out the main cutting, polishing, sink cut-outs, hob cut-outs, tap holes, drainer grooves and edge finishing off site using suitable workshop controls.

We do not treat uncontrolled dry cutting of engineered quartz as a normal site method. Where any essential adjustment is required, the work must be considered carefully and controlled with appropriate methods, because engineered stone dust needs responsible handling. This protects the customer, the property and the fitting team.

For Camberley homeowners, this means the kitchen must be ready before templating: units fixed, level and secure, sinks and hobs selected, appliance information available and support panels in place. The more accurate the template, the less adjustment is needed on installation day.

Safe fabrication also improves the finished result. Polished internal sink edges, clean hob openings, accurate drainer grooves, neat seams, straight upstands and refined edge profiles are all easier to achieve when the quartz is prepared in a controlled workshop environment.

Pricing guide

How Much Do Quartz Worktops Cost in Camberley?

Quartz prices vary because every Camberley kitchen has different dimensions, slab requirements, colour choices, thicknesses, cut-outs and access conditions. A compact apartment run will price differently from a family kitchen island with waterfall ends and matching splashbacks.

Quote factorWhat changes the cost
Quartz brand and rangePlain, speckled, marble-effect and premium veined quartz ranges can price differently.
20mm or 30mm thicknessThickness affects material use, visual weight and edge detailing.
Cut-outs and groovesSink cut-outs, hob cut-outs, tap holes and drainer grooves add fabrication time.
Upstands and splashbacksMatching quartz wall pieces increase material, templating and installation work.
Access and handlingFlats, stairs, lifts, tight turns, parking and large slabs may need extra planning.

Straight quartz runs

Usually the simplest quotation, affected mainly by length, depth, brand, thickness and whether cut-outs or upstands are needed.

L-shaped and U-shaped kitchens

These layouts need careful seam planning, corner checks, wall-line templating and accurate appliance positions.

Quartz islands

Island prices depend on slab size, seating overhangs, support, edge profile, waterfall ends and access into the property.

Quartz splashbacks

Full-height or hob splashbacks increase material and fitting work but create a cleaner, more premium quartz finish.
